Real-World Examples and Case Studies
While "ijj wattu002639" is a specific example, there are countless similar strings floating around. Let's look at a few hypothetical scenarios to illustrate how these codes might be used.
- Example 1: Electronics Product: Imagine you buy a new smartphone, and the box has a sticker with the code "ABC PhoneX12345." "ABC" might be the manufacturer's initials, "PhoneX" could be the product line, and "12345" is the unique serial number. You could use this number to register your phone for warranty or download software updates.
- Example 2: Online Order: You order a pair of shoes online, and your confirmation email includes the order ID "ShoeCo ORD78901." "ShoeCo" is likely the retailer's name, "ORD" signifies that it's an order ID, and "78901" is your specific order number. You'd use this number to track your shipment or contact customer service.
- Example 3: Internal Document: You're working on a project at your company, and a document is labeled "ProjectAlpha DOC2468." "ProjectAlpha" is the project's name, "DOC" indicates that it's a document, and "2468" is the document's unique identifier. This helps your team organize and track different versions of the document.
